Oman - Import of Sesame Oil or Fractions
Since 2014, Oman Import of Sesame Oil or Fractions was up 8.1% year on year. At $416,982.26 in 2019, the country was number 43 among other countries in Import of Sesame Oil or Fractions. Oman is overtaken by Sri Lanka, which was number 42 with $464,794.01 and is followed by Belize at $403,713.72. United States lead the ranking with $97,760,610.57 in 2019, +1.7% versus 2018. Canada, United Kingdom and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Nigeria witnessed the best average annual growth at +102% per year, while Ethiopia was the worst growing country at -68.1% per year.
